General Manager Visa Sponsorship Jobs in Louisiana
Louisiana's general manager roles span the state's energy sector in Baton Rouge and Houma, hospitality and tourism operations in New Orleans, and manufacturing along the Mississippi River corridor. Companies like Entergy, Turner Industries, and major hotel groups have sponsored work visas for senior operations talent. The H-1B visa and EB-3 are the most common pathways for qualified international candidates.

Which companies in Louisiana sponsor visas for general managers?
Energy and industrial employers are among the most active sponsors for general manager roles in Louisiana. Companies like Entergy, Turner Industries, and Huntsman Corporation have H-1B and PERM filing histories for senior operations and management positions. Large hospitality groups operating in New Orleans, including major hotel chains, have also sponsored international managers. Sponsorship activity is concentrated in energy, petrochemicals, manufacturing, and hospitality.
Which visa types are most common for general manager roles in Louisiana?
The H-1B is the most common visa for general managers, provided the role requires a bachelor's degree or higher in a specific field such as business administration, engineering, or operations management. Employers pursuing permanent placement often file for EB-3 or EB-2 green cards through PERM labor certification. Multinational companies with Louisiana operations may also use the L-1A intracompany transferee visa for managers moving from an overseas office.
Which cities in Louisiana have the most general manager sponsorship jobs?
New Orleans generates the highest volume of general manager sponsorship activity, driven by its hospitality, tourism, and logistics sectors. Baton Rouge follows closely, anchored by energy companies, petrochemical manufacturers, and state government contractors. Shreveport and Lafayette also see demand, particularly in oil and gas services and regional retail or food service operations. Roles in the greater New Orleans metro tend to draw the most international hiring interest.

What should international candidates know about general manager roles in Louisiana specifically?
Louisiana's economy is heavily weighted toward energy, petrochemicals, and hospitality, so general manager candidates with experience in those sectors will find the strongest sponsorship pipeline. The state's Gulf Coast location means operations management roles often involve shift work, safety compliance, and environmental regulatory knowledge. Tulane University and Louisiana State University produce local business graduates, but employers in specialized industries regularly recruit internationally when domestic talent pipelines don't meet technical or operational requirements.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ored general manager jobs in Louisiana?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
